Don't use JsonBuffer to create or parse objects and arrays.
* Added DynamicJsonArray and StaticJsonArray * Added DynamicJsonObject and StaticJsonObject * Added DynamicJsonVariant and StaticJsonVariant * Added deserializeJson() * Removed JsonBuffer::parseArray(), parseObject() and parse() * Removed JsonBuffer::createArray() and createObject()
